The Iowa State University Foundation is charged with the rewarding task of fundraising for the university. Together, we work as a team to expertly match our donors’ passions with Iowa State’s needs.

The first gift to Iowa State was made in 1899 by alumnus and former professor Edgar Stanton, who donated the original 10 bells of the Campanile. Without this first gift, and all the generous gifts since then, Iowa State’s campus would be completely different. The foundation honors this tradition today by finding new ways to move Iowa State University forward – whether through scholarship support, funding leading-edge facilities, creating new opportunities, or recruiting the best faculty.

Job Description:

This position collaborates with foundation colleagues and university partners to develop highly persuasive and personalized content for communications that help inspire and generate private and corporate support and steward donors.

Core respon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Meet with and interview ISU Foundation and university colleagues to conduct research, create content strategy, and write concepts, proposals, case statements, impact reports, and other communications that inform, engage, and motivate individual, foundation, and corporate donor prospects to support Iowa State’s funding priorities.
  • Employ persuasive writing techniques to convert audiences from interest to action.
  • Ensure projects are delivered on time, within budget, and aligned with stakeholder expectations.
  • Develop and maintain processes to streamline workflow, create efficiencies, and meet a growing demand for development communications needs.
  • Edit copy for accuracy, effectiveness, and ISU Foundation style. Serve as an in-house expert in matters of grammar, usage, and style.
  • Manage day-to-day operational aspects and progression of projects. Meet and manage multiple deadlines; inform team members and supervisor of potential issues.

Qualifications

Education & Work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ree; preferably in communications, English, journalism, liberal arts, or related field.
  • 3-5 years of professional experience, preferably in advancement communications. Prefer experience in proposal writing, grant writing, narrative non-fiction, creative writing, or marketing.

Desired Skills & Experience

  • Advanced communication skills (both written and verbal). Attention to detail is essential.
  • Demonstrated ability as a versatile, creative, and persuasive writer. A proven track record of funded proposals and/or grant applications is preferred.
  • Ability to synthesize large quantities of information and turn institutional objectives into compelling cases for support.
  • Excellent proofreading and editing skills; familiarity with AP style. Excellent listening and interviewing skills.
  • Ability to work independently and in a team setting; ability to navigate working with a variety of personalities.
  • Must handle multiple activities simultaneously with attention and adherence to deadlines and accuracy.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office.
  • Must be able to handle confidential information with a high level of discretion.
  • Creativity, patience, a sense of humor and a belief in our organizational mission of: Aligning donor passion and generosity to advance Iowa State University’s land grant ideals.
